    We are an upcycling community consisting of Kim, Torsten, Marvin, Martin, Niklas, Linda, Pieter (10 years old), and Lotta (7 years old). We live in Duisburg, on the border of the Ruhr area. The Rhine River, surrounded by greenery, is 1 km away, and the small city center is only a 300-meter walk away.

    We bought our first house with a garden 10 years ago and recently acquired the house next door, which is connected to ours. Right now, our main focus is on renovating this new property, and we are looking for helping hands to work on these renovation projects with us. Beyond renovation, we also enjoy creative decorating, interior design, and gardening.

    In our 300 m² house, you will stay in a shared room with another Workawayer and have access to our comfortable kitchen, living room, and a shared bathroom. You will need to cook for yourself, but we provide all the food and groceries you need. We usually work together and support each other on projects throughout the day.

    The Ruhr region is an interesting mix of beautiful wild spaces of forests, rivers and lakes with also metropolitan city culture and industry in Duisburg, and a melting pot of cultures with large Turkish, Italian, Russian and Spanish communities. Its multicultural 5 million inhabitants makes for a very colourful and diverse experience with many unique cultural activities on offer.

    In the region you can discover exotic restaurants, cultural spaces, markets such as the middle age market and many festivals such as Carnival, Park to Shine, CSD and Japanese day.

    Our Current Project: Turning a House into a Home!

    About the Project
    We are currently in the middle of an exciting renovation project! We’ve recently taken on a new house connected to ours and are working hard to restore and improve it. We are primarily looking for someone to help us directly with the renovations, as well as keeping our living space clean and maintained while we build.

    The Help We Need
    Your time will mainly be split between hands-on building tasks and keeping the household in order:

    DIY: Assisting with diy projects, restoring spaces, and working with tools alongside us.

    Cleaning: Routine cleaning and keeping common areas tidy to manage the dust and mess that comes with ongoing work.

    Small Odd Jobs: Light gardening or minor upkeep tasks as they pop up.

    The Schedule & Flow
    Our renovation schedule follows a clear rhythm:

    We work in the week as much as we can

    For you it will be a max of 5h a day

    Saturdays: This is our big "team day" where we all work together on the renovation.

    Note on your days off: Since Saturday is a shared work day where we expect everyone to help out together, you can pick any other day of the week to take as your day off in exchange. We are flexible and want to make sure you have dedicated time to relax or explore the area.

    What We Offer
    A practical, hardworking environment with clear tasks and independent living arrangements. If you enjoy hands-on renovation work and keeping a project space clean and organized, we’d love to have your help!

    The house is over 100 years old, and we've tried to preserve as much of its original character as possible. You may share a room with one other Workawayer. Everyone shares access to the kitchen, bathroom, living room, sauna, garden with hot tub, and laundry room. For more information, please contact us.

    We participate in a large food-sharing project that saves food from large corporations, so we always have plenty of food and groceries in the house that you are welcome to use. You will need to cook for yourself, but all the food you need is fully provided. We are also happy to tell you more about how the food-saving project works!
